Distro — Free Sales Engagement Platform
Sequences, cloud call center, shared inbox, form tracking and more — on a single platform. Double your sales team's output with fewer tools.
Create a sequence — it's free
Steel People
steel people is a company based out of 3450 w central ave, suite 360, toledo, ohio, united states.
Frequently asked questions about Steel People
Let us help answer the most common questions you might have.
Where is Steel People located?
Steel People's headquarters is located at Toledo, Ohio, United States, 43606
What is Steel People's official website?
Steel People's official website is steelpeople.com
What is Steel People's SIC code?
What is Steel People's NAICS code?
How many employees does Steel People have?
Steel People has 0 employees
What are Steel People's social media links?
Steel People Linkedin page
Distro — Free Sales Engagement Platform
Sequences, cloud call center, shared inbox, form tracking and more — on a single platform. Double your sales team's output with fewer tools.
Create a sequence — it's free